Today I guided Bruce and Hal for ducks. With the weatherman calling for wind and rain I decided to head for the rice near Delevan Refuge. We rode to the blind in the wind and rain and just as expected, once in the blind the rain quit! At legal shooting time there were a few birds flying and Bruce smoked the first duck that came in. We sat waiting patiently but there just wasn't much flying but a few birds here and there that would not listen no matter how hard I tried. Around 9:00 the rain started and the ducks started flying! Between 9:00 and 11:30 Bruce and Hal took down another 13 ducks and 1 speck. The hunting was by no means fast and furious but we stuck it out and the guys ended up with a great strap of birds!

Today I guided Randall Walker for ducks. We hit the rice and had a stiff North wind blowing and plenty of birds flying, however, they were 99% sprig! It didn't take long for us to bag our 4 sprig and then we sat and watched the show as group after group of sprig worked the decoys. As we sat watching the sprig every now and then something else would sneak in and we would put the hammer on them! We stuck it out until 10:30 and ended the hunt with 13 ducks and a speck! It always amazes me how the sprig come out of the wood work when the North wind blows!
